The Lok Janshakti Party is a state political party in the state of Bihar, India. It is led by Ram Vilas Paswan. The party was formed in 2000 when Paswan split from Janata Dal. The party has considerable following amongst Dalits in Bihar. Currently the party is a member of the National Democratic Alliance. Read More
